Independence with atonic drop seizures

Mon, 08/28/2006 - 02:35
Although I had partial seizures (with an aura) since I was about 3 years old, I did not start having atonic drop seizures until I was in my middle 40's. Not too long after I started having them, I opted out of the company when they offered early retirement. And because I earned a halfway decent salary, I have some money tucked away and I get somewhat decent disability benefits. For almost 10 years, everything was fine. Because of where I lived, the bus stop was only a short distance from our house. As a result, I'd take the bus to the mall, Barnes and Noble, etc. and make a day of it. Never once did I have a problem even though I was alone. Unfortunately, the family member that I was living with retired about 2 years ago. She has felt the need to supervise me ever since. I am ready to walk out and leave everything behind me. I had an uncle who also had seizures and, when the family pressure became too much, he left and didn't surface for about 2 years. I am ready to do the same thing. As a result, I have been doing some research about which cities have the lowest cost of living and a decent transportation system. Have you done this? Would you provide me with the name of the city that you live in? Have you been happy with your choice? If you went back to the other city, did you still have problems with your relatives?
